Domestic Air Traffic Report for March 2017 by DGCA
|
|
|
|
The Directorate General of Civil Aviation (DGCA) analysed the air traffic data submitted by various domestic
airlines for March 2017. According to the monthly traffic data, passengers carried by domestic airlines during
January to March 2017 were 272.79 lakh as against 230.03 lakh during the corresponding period last year,
thereby registering a growth of 18.59%. TravelBiz Monitor presents highlights.

Cancellations
The overall cancellation rate of scheduled domestic airlines for March 2017 has been 0.41%.
Passenger Complaints during the month
During March 2017, a total of 680 passenger related complaints had been received by the scheduled domestic airlines. The number of complaints per
10,000 passengers carried for March 2017 has been around 0.75.
